Imogen Thomas’s Reviews > The Lamb > Status Update

Imogen Thomas
Imogen Thomas is on page 68 of 336
Sep 04, 2025 09:15PM
The Lamb

flag

Imogen’s Previous Updates

Imogen Thomas
Imogen Thomas is on page 178 of 336
Jan 10, 2026 06:23PM
The Lamb


Imogen Thomas
Imogen Thomas is on page 117 of 336
Dec 16, 2025 07:58PM
The Lamb


No comments have been added yet.